Onboarding: Nightly search reindex — Lanternview Catalog team

The reindex job rebuilds the product search index for Lanternview every night at 02:00. It reads from the catalog replica, never the primary, so confirm REINDEX_SOURCE=replica before any run. Keep REINDEX_PARALLELISM at 4 in staging; higher values starve the replica of IO. Failed runs leave the previous index intact, so partial states are impossible. The indexer authenticates to the search cluster with a credential set on the next line.

env line for fafof-fahag: LEDGER_TOKEN5=f8790

## Service Accounts — StormFan Alert Fan-Out

The fan-out worker authenticates to the internal dispatch tier using the svc-stormfan account. Rotate quarterly; scopes are limited to publish-only on alert topics. If deliveries stall during your shift, verify the worker is using the current credential, reproduced below for reference.

API key for kaweg-hahif: kto4_rAjZ

14:32 — Okay, this is where it got interesting. Webhook delivery in Pondrel was retrying failed posts with a fixed 2-second interval, no backoff, so when the Marletta endpoint went down we basically DDoSed ourselves. Jonno shipped a patch adding exponential backoff with jitter and a 6-attempt cap. Retries now also dedupe on event key, so partners stop seeing doubles. The patched build that went to canary at 14:40 is referenced below.

trace token, fafog-kageg: htk4_98e6